Does Your SIM Card Come With a Number?
Yes, your SIM card absolutely comes with a number. It's not just a piece of plastic; it's the key that connects your phone to the mobile network and gives you your unique phone number. Think of it as your digital identity in the mobile world. Without it, you wouldn't be able to make calls, send texts, or use mobile data.
The confusion might arise from the process of getting a new phone number. Sometimes, it feels like the number is assigned to the phone itself. However, the number is actually tied to the SIM card, a small, removable chip that stores this crucial information along with other data like your network authorization details. This means you can generally move your number between compatible phones simply by switching the SIM card.
